Role of the human globus pallidus in tremorgenesis

The GPi is a nucleus that serves as an output of the basal ganglia; a collection of nuclei which function in selecting movements to be executed. Tremor is defined as an unintentional, rhythmic, sinusoidal contraction of body parts. Currently, no scientific consensus has been reached as to where in the brain tremor arises. Using microelectrode recordings in human patients with and without tremor, we discovered a sub-population of cells that are capable of being induced into a brief theta oscillation following microstimulation. However, we found that theta burst stimulation was incapable of inducing visible tremor when microstimulating in the GPi, Vim, or STN. We also found preliminary evidence that this theta oscillation is capable of producing an LTP-like response within the GPi. We believe that this work adds strength to the “pallidocentric” view of tremor initiation which holds that the GPi is responsible for the onset of tremor.
